site stats

Dfs of a tree

WebJun 17, 2024 · DFS: LIFO (Last In First Out) We are going to get the help of stack, in order to traverse the tree/graph DFS way. Add the visited Node to stack. Pop the Node from stack, explore its children and add them to stack. Explore all the nodes till stack becomes empty. Here we are going to see pre-order traversal of the below tree using stack. WebThese edges will form a tree, called the depth-first-search tree of G starting at the given root, and the edges in this tree are called tree edges. The other edges of G can be …

Certificate path verification in peer-to-peer public key ...

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the root node in the case of a graph) and explores as far as possible along each branch before backtracking. Extra memory, usually a stack, is needed to keep track of the nodes discovered so far along a specified branch … WebFeb 20, 2024 · DFS is better when target is far from source. Suitability for decision tree. As BFS considers all neighbor so it is not suitable for decision tree used in puzzle games. DFS is more suitable for decision tree. As with one decision, we need to traverse further to augment the decision. If we reach the conclusion, we won. Speed. BFS is slower than DFS. high score tech supply https://fatlineproductions.com

Depth-First Search - LeetCode

WebDepth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the root (selecting some arbitrary node as the root in the case of a graph) and explore as far as possible along each branch before backtracking. The following graph shows the order in which the nodes are discovered in DFS: Web268 rows · Find a Corresponding Node of a Binary Tree in a Clone of That Tree. 86.7%: Easy: 1391: Check if There is a Valid Path in a Grid. 47.3%: Medium: 1448: Count Good … high score soundtrack

DFS Algorithm DFS Spanning Tree and Traversal Sequence - EDUCBA

Category:DraftKings DFS Fantasy Golf Cheat Sheet: 2024 PGA TOUR RBC …

Tags:Dfs of a tree

Dfs of a tree

Certificate path verification in peer-to-peer public key ...

WebSep 28, 2024 · DFS in Binary tree To understand the Depth-first search in the Binary tree, we first need to know why it is called the Depth-first search. A binary tree is a hierarchical representation of nodes ... WebDFS Traversal of a Tree Using Recursion. A tree is a non-linear data structure, which consists of nodes and edges that represent a hierarchical structure. It is a connected …

Dfs of a tree

Did you know?

WebDec 6, 2015 · Algorithm DFS (Tree): initialize stack to contain Tree.root () while stack is not empty: p = stack.pop () perform 'action' for p for each child 'c' in Tree.children (p): stack.push (c) This will search through all the nodes of tree whether binary or not. To implement search and return.. modify the algorithm accordingly. WebFind a Corresponding Node of a Binary Tree in a Clone of That Tree. 86.7%: Easy: 1391: Check if There is a Valid Path in a Grid. 47.3%: Medium: 1448: Count Good Nodes in Binary Tree. 74.3%: Medium: 1443: Minimum Time to Collect All Apples in a Tree. 62.7%: Medium: 1462: Course Schedule IV. 49.0%: Medium: 1457: Pseudo-Palindromic Paths in a ...

WebApr 12, 2024 · Yahoo Value Picks. Based on $200 salary cap. Cream of the Crop. Scottie Scheffler - $45. An ice-cold putter throughout Rounds 1 and 2 at Augusta National made it difficult for Scheffler to contend in his Masters defense effort this past weekend, ultimately placing T10 as he averaged a disappointing 1.76 putts per GIR. WebBalachandra, Rao, A & Prema, KV 2011, Certificate path verification in peer-to-peer public key infrastructures by constructing DFS spanning tree. in Advances in Computer Science and Information Technology - First International Conference on Computer Science and Information Technology, CCSIT 2011, Proceedings. PART 1 edn, vol. 131 CCIS, …

WebJan 17, 2024 · 4. Inorder Traversal. Inorder Traversal is the one the most used variant of DFS(Depth First Search) Traversal of the tree. As DFS suggests, we will first focus on the depth of the chosen Node and then … WebDFS Traversal of a Tree Using Recursion. A tree is a non-linear data structure, which consists of nodes and edges that represent a hierarchical structure. It is a connected graph with no cycles. A tree with “n” nodes should always contain “n-1” edges. Tree traversal is one of the most basic requirements for dealing with different types ...

WebAug 3, 2024 · In pre-order traversal of a binary tree, we first traverse the root, then the left subtree and then finally the right subtree. We do this recursively to benefit from the fact …

WebIntroduction to Iterative Tree Traversals. In recursive DFS traversal of a binary tree, we have three basic elements to traverse: the root node, the left subtree, and the right subtree.Each traversal process nodes in a different order using recursion, where the recursive code is simple and easy to visualize i.e. one function parameter and 3-4 lines of code. how many dashes are in a bottle of bittersWebTrees and Forests q A (free) tree is an undirected graph T such that n T is connected n T has no cycles This definition of tree is different from the one of ... (DFS) is a general … how many data breaches 2020Web1.Take any arbitary node as the root node . 2.Run dfs from that node and find the farthest node. 3.let this node be x . 4.Now run dfs from this node to the farthest away node , let … high score xrd p30downloadWebApr 10, 2024 · For DFS purposes, getting 6/6 players through the cut will undoubtedly be tougher than it was last week in the smaller field. The Course. Harbour Town Golf Links, Hilton Head, South Carolina ... the par 3s all measure in at a range of just 175-200 yards, a mix of small greens, water hazards, and overhanging trees make them all tough to … how many dashes of bitters equal one ounceWebNov 2, 2016 · Tree Traversal – BFS and DFS – Introduction, Explanation and Implementation. Traversing a tree refers to visiting each node once. Interestingly, a tree … high score turfWebApr 23, 2024 · 1. The fact that DFS does not determine uniquely the resulting labeling is due to the fact that there is no order in which the children of a node are visited. To my … how many data analysts are there in the worldWebDFS vs BFS. Breadth-first search is less space-efficient than depth-first search because BFS keeps a priority queue of the entire frontier while DFS maintains a few pointers at … how many data breaches are human error